335402 2005-03-18 10:03:00 Is it possible to transfer to address book from Tbird to Eudora.

Phil
Phil B (648)
335403 2005-03-18 11:15:00 I believe that Eudora can import addressbooks in ldif format - see here (www.eudora.com)

So all you need to do in Thunderbird is export (kb.mozillazine.org ess_Books) in this format.
